A 3.5 Inch Live Steam Hunslet 0-4-0 Saddle Tank Steam Locomotive Named Dolbadarn R/No 3, plus a four-wheel wood construction tender (with coal), fitted with twin o/s cylinders, Stephenson's valve gear, usual backhead controls and instruction, the locomotive is built to a very good standard and finished in dark red and black with brass plate stating built by Harry Holroyd 1984. There are no build plans etc, but included are photographs of the model under steam plus a boiler certificate to May 1990, overall length with tender 42 inch (display track included), of interest 'The Original Loco was built by The Hunslet Engine Co Ltd, No 1430/1922 and supplied new to Port Dinorwic for quay use, eventually acquired by Lake Railway in 1969, returned to service 1997
